Cross Country Men 2nd, Women 5th At ISU Redbird Invite

NORMAL, Ill. – Eastern Illinois men's and women's cross country returned to action on Friday evening as the Panthers competed at the Illinois State Redbird Invite.
 
The EIU men placed second in the 8K event while the EIU women were fifth running at the 6K distance.
 
Dustin Hatfield competed in his first meet of the season placing third with a time of 24:09.5.  Former EIU cross country runner Jaime Marcos was the event winner running unattached with Christopher Collet of Wartburg placing second. 
 
Wartburg would win the men's race scoring 43 points with Eastern Illinois second with 54 points and host Illinois State in third.
 
On the women's side Butler would win the women's title followed by Wartburg in second.  The EIU women placed fifth with Kate Bushue the top Panther finisher in 20th with a time of 22:47.5.
 
Andrew Pilat and Adam Swanson both turned in top ten finishes for the EIU men.  Pilat was sixth with a time of 24:51.2.  Swanson was 10th with a time of 25:06.4.
 
Richie Jacobo and Josh Whitaker rounded out the five scored EIU runners.  Jacobo was 17th crossing in 25:35.3 while Whitaker was 23rd with a time of 25:55.5.
 
On the women's side Sarah Carr and Mackenzie Aldridge followed behind Bushue in the top 30 for EIU.  Carr was 24th with a time of 22:58.2  Aldridge was 27th with a time of 23:11.4. 
 
Sam Mabry and Breanna Sheldon were the final two EIU women's scored runners.  Mabry was 33rd with a time of 23:27.0.  Sheldon was 41st with a time of 23:58.0.
 
Mason Stoeger and Noah Schalliol closed out the top seven EIU men's runners.  Stoeger in 31st at 26:09.4 and Schalliol in 38th at 26:25.7.
 
Alex Gomez and Katie Springer closed out the top seven EIU women's runners. Gomez in 42nd at 23:59.5 and Springer in 47th at 24:10.5.
